Seaside Storm Flood Realities
Water damage in Seaside tends to cluster in predictable windows because of the local climate. Seaside, California is prone to flooding due to its coastal location and proximity to the Salinas River. Heavy rainfall events, especially during the winter months, can lead to significant water intrusion into homes and businesses. Additionally, rising sea levels and storm surges contribute to recurrent flooding risks in low-lying areas.
Seaside experiences a Mediterranean climate with dry summers and wet winters. The region is also susceptible to periodic high-tide flooding, which can overwhelm drainage systems and cause water to back up into residential and commercial properties.
